Learn tips & techniques for harvesting, handling, processing, prepping, and preparing ten of the most productive Sonoran Desert plants: saguaro, mesquite, mormon tea, prickly pear, ocotillo, wolfberry, jojoba, hackberry, ironwood, and palo verde. Plus learn about seasonality, flavors, varieties, and other fine points of their bounty. FORMAT: In-Person – lecture. The number one cause of Level I traumas transported to ER is injury resulting from a fall. This 7-class series helps older adults improve their strength, coordination, and balance -and- reduces their fear of falling by learning to view falls as controllable. Benefits of class: set goals for increasing activity levels. exercise to increase strength and balance. reduce barriers to exercise. identify physical risk factors for falls and recognize misconceptions [...]
